Output 84c1030dbbf4b28bf0c02db9f5821259fdc4c15d44baeb21b5d79304d872926d:1

value
2829644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 637e9495c5f79357d5dcc7d79753e151f7311eeb OP_EQUAL
address
3Am6TVj1XgqGQCzW8bqFHn1MSc9E7Pf1ox
transaction
84c1030dbbf4b28bf0c02db9f5821259fdc4c15d44baeb21b5d79304d872926d
spent
true